About Starke Ayres

Starke Ayres is the leading African specialist and a globally recognized supplier of premium vegetable, flower, and lawn seed varieties. With a long-standing reputation for quality, innovation, and agricultural excellence, the company serves both commercial farming operations and home gardeners across South Africa and international markets.

Built on a foundation of trust and superior seed performance, Starke Ayres is committed to helping growers achieve optimal results while contributing to sustainable food production. The company continuously invests in research, quality control, and skilled personnel to maintain its position as a market leader in the seed industry.

Position Overview: Picker Packer

Starke Ayres is currently se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Picker Packer to join its warehouse operations in Kempton Park. This role is essential to ensuring that customer orders are accurately picked, prepared, and dispatched in line with strict quality and stock control standards.

The successful candidate will play a vital role in maintaining product quality, inventory accuracy, and customer satisfaction by ensuring that all seed products are correctly handled, packaged, and recorded.

This opportunity is ideal for individuals with warehouse experience who are organised, dependable, and capable of working in a fast-paced distribution environment.


Key Responsibilities

As a Picker Packer, your duties will include:

  • Picking products accurately according to customer orders
  • Assembling and preparing orders for transfer to the checking and dispatch area
  • Verifying correct seed reference numbers during picking and reporting any discrepancies to the Stock Controller
  • Notifying management of out-of-stock items and awaiting further instructions
  • Ensuring all products are clean, properly packaged, correctly labelled, and in saleable condition
  • Maintaining high quality standards in appearance, packaging, and presentation
  • Assisting colleagues once assigned duties are completed
  • Keeping all work areas neat, organised, and clean at all times
  • Supporting security procedures to protect stock, assets, and warehouse facilities
  • Assisting with invoicing of customer orders when required
  • Helping walk-in customers with product information and basic queries
  • Participating in bi-annual and ad hoc stock counts as directed by the Stock Controller
